CVE-2026-1509 - Avada (Fusion) Builder <= 3.15.1 - Authenticated (Subscriber+) Limited Arbitrary WordPress Action Execution
CVE ID :CVE-2026-1509
Published : April 15, 2026, 1:25 a.m. | 1 hour, 49 minutes ago
Description :The Avada (Fusion) Builder pl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Arbitrary WordPress Action Execution in all versions up to, and including, 3.15.1. This is due to the plugin's `output_action_hook()` function accepting user-controlled input to trigger any registered WordPress action hook without proper authorization checks.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Subscriber-level access and above, to execute arbitrary WordPress action hooks via the Dynamic Data feature, potentially leading to privilege escalation, file inclusion, denial of service, or other security impacts depending on which action hooks are available in the WordPress installation.
